97388
ZIP 97388 has lower-than-average household income, with a median household income of $73,750. Population has held roughly steady since 2024. Median home value is $553,600. With a median age of 59.0, the population is older than the US median of 38.9. Poverty is rare here, at 4.0% of residents. Among the 14 ZIP codes in Lincoln County, 97388 ranks 4th by median household income.
How many people live in ZIP code 97388?
ZIP code 97388 has about 911 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in ZIP code 97388?
The typical household in ZIP code 97388 earns about $73,750 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is ZIP code 97388 expensive?
In ZIP code 97388, the median home is worth about $553,600.
How educated are people in ZIP code 97388?
About 32.0%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 97388 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 97388?
About 4.0% of people in ZIP code 97388 live below the federal poverty line.
